The average rule of thumb is 1.5 to 2 times your vehicle weight. The reason is that you only get Max pulling power on the first wrap(layer) then as the drum fills up it gets larger and the capacity goes down. So for most of us in a 3rd gen that means either an 8000 or 9500 will be adequate. My bumper is in process and I am planning on putting in a 8000lb. I figure as I sit with armor and all my trail gear in the truck I am around the 5k lb mark, so will be at the minimum of 1.5 times vehicle weight.

just get a snatch block to double the purchase on the winch line. easier on the motor. and no, i dont have a winch yet. just a sailor that knows about loads v. purchase
Another good thing is not only does a double line pull with a block give you a 2:1 ratio,it also allows you to run more line out. This uses more of your winches power to begin with, remember the more line you have off your drum the closer you are to the rated capacity.
